Since a 220 pf capacitor with ½" leads self-resonates somewhere around 150
MHz., you might want to do the old "put a variable capacitor between screen
and cathode and tune for minimum squeeg" trick. All you are doing is making
a series resonant circuit with the stray inductance of the tube and the
variable capacitor to short whatever nasties you don't want out.
